Core answer: Bahrain's 3-0 win over Oman in the AVC Men's Volleyball Asian Championship Fukuoka was eliminated due to point-ratio tiebreakers, allowing India to advance as the second-best third-placed team and qualify for the 2027 World Cup and 2028 Olympics. Key facts: Bahrain defeated Oman 25-16, 25-19, 25-23; outside hitters Sayed Hashem Ali and Fallah Saleem Al-Aabed Mubarak Al Jaradi scored 13 points each; Bahrain middle blocker Hasan Haider Mohamed recorded 7 kill blocks and 11 points; Oman opposite Majid Abdallah Ali Al-Shibli scored 11 points.
